Anyhow I am rambling (this is my first post here) The only downside so far is that the optical drive performance seems real slow real slow compared to the desktop drives. Is this normal with Laptops?? Should I get an external usb/firewire burner/reader? Portability isn't important to me for this aspect since most of my loading of software will be from home.
I also had problems installing Call of Duty, it took me 3 hours to finally get working... it was stating that it could not find default.cfg file and every post on the net said that I was installing to the root folder instead of a directory, NOT... D:\Call of Duty whas the path I was installing to. So as a last resort I copied the entire installation from my desktop pc over the current install and low and behold it worked fine after that. So it looks like the drive doesn't like those 2 discs as everything else reads fine (yet slow.)
